【Memcached】分布式内存对象缓存系统

Memcached是一个自由开源的,高性能,分布式内存对象缓存系统。

Memcached是以LiveJournal旗下Danga Interactive公司的Brad Fitzpatric为首开发的一款软件。现在已成为mixi、hatena、Facebook、Vox、LiveJournal等众多服务中提高Web应用扩展性的重要因素。

Memcached是一种基于内存的key-value存储,用来存储小块的任意数据(字符串、对象)。这些数据可以是数据库调用、API调用或者是页面渲染的结果。

Memcached简洁而强大。它的简洁设计便于快速开发,减轻开发难度,解决了大数据量缓存的很多问题。它的API兼容大部分流行的开发语言。

本质上,它是一个简洁的key-value存储系统。

一般的使用目的是,通过缓存数据库查询结果,减少数据库访问次数,以提高动态Web应用的速度、提高可扩展性。

 

缺点:

1.不能作为持久化保存

2.存储数据有限制:1M

3.存储数据只能使用key-value

4.集群数据没有复制和同步机制

5.内存回收不及时

 

官网

http://memcached.org/

 

Memcached下载与安装

https://www.runoob.com/memcached/window-install-memcached.html

 

memcacheddotnet_clientlib-1.1.5

链接:https://pan.baidu.com/s/1NfuvRW7HsCBh3ZRyO9fKrw 
提取码:seqq 
 

 

命令行连接

以管理员身份运行命令行

输入cd G:\迅雷下载\memcached-win64-1.4.4-14\memcached 进入memcached.exe目录

输入G:

输入cls

输入memcached>memcached.exe -d install安装服务

输入telnet 127.0.0.1 11211连接服务器

 

 

参考

https://www.cnblogs.com/edisonchou/p/3855969.html

 

 

 

 

 

你可能感兴趣的:(Memcached)